You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ailThe Lancaster County Detention Center is seeking an experienced and motivated leader to serve as our Jail Administrator. In addition to the duties listed below the ideal candidate will have a strong background in policy and process development. As we prepare for the opening of a new Detention Center this position will have the overall responsibility for developing the new policies and procedures associated with the new facility.
Responsible for the supervision of daily center operations ensuring the safety and security of inmates staff and the citizens of Lancaster County through the efficient and effective enforcement of policies and procedures. Reports to the Chief Deputy.
Supervises subordinate Detention Supervisors; supervisory duties include instructing planning and assigning work reviewing work maintaining standards coordinating activities acting on employee problems selecting new employees and recommending employee transfers promotions discipline and discharge. Evaluates the work of subordinates; offers advice and assistance as required.
Coordinates South Carolina Department of Corrections Inspections to make sure minimum standards are met.
Ensures the proper maintenance and timely repair of facility equipment as needed by coordinating with county maintenance.
Conducts weekly inspections of the entire facility including cells and inmate property.
Receives and reviews time sheets arrest reports citation reports bond payments commitments bond hearing certifications warrants and citations victim forms summonses memos etc.
Prepares and/or processes performance appraisals training records weekly/monthly/annual reports purchase orders invoices and inventory records;
Supervises officers that process jail list booking reports property release forms hold form both Live Scan and physical fingerprint cards intake forms visitation log daily log waivers various other logs reports records memos correspondence etc.
Requires a high school diploma or GED equivalent (preferred educational level of Bachelors degree in Criminal Justice or related field) supplemented by ten years of experience as a Detention Center or Corrections Supervisor or any equivalent combination of training and experience which provides the required knowledge skills and abilities. Must hold required South Carolina Class 2 and SCCJA Jail Management certifications or be able to obtain them within 1 year of hire. Must possess a valid drivers license.
